Transaction 63890aca74276966492949adf8e7b7b7a81a992bb06046f8ecae9df5b27bfd79
1 Input
1 Output
-
63890aca74276966492949adf8e7b7b7a81a992bb06046f8ecae9df5b27bfd79:0
- value
- 6993247
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ec7867e1682df3a67d9c4bd7934146c788139617 OP_EQUAL
- address
- 3PFMdkp9yqd94b9zAvCrp1kHeuyEcjWNNv